## Authentication

Flagpath rollouts require a service token for all write operations. Read-only flag evaluation is unauthenticated inside the mesh. If a rollout stalls, check token expiry first — tokens rotate every 30 days via the Quillgate rotator. Do not mint tokens manually; page the platform channel if rotation fails. For emergency overrides during an incident, the on-call escalation path uses the break-glass key below.

app token of bawep-hafog = kto7_vwrmnlx

Ticket VLT-218: The localization vault holding the date-format resource bundles for Tidemark is locked after three failed attempts. New team members: these bundles control regional date rendering (day-month ordering, separators, era labels), so nothing ships until the vault reopens. Do not retry blindly; that extends the lockout. Follow the standard unlock flow and, when prompted, supply the recovery passphrase given immediately below.

vault phrase of hahop-badug = novvan-ulaion-zorius-noviel-gorwyn-casix-tamys

So, the Coinloom converter occasionally drifts a cent or two because of banker's rounding in the legacy FX path. Before shipping the fix, make sure the new precision flag is on and that the reconciliation job can reach the rates vault — otherwise it silently falls back to cached rates and the rounding patch does nothing. Once you've verified the flag, add this line to the release host's .env file.

env line for kageg-fajof: COURIER_KEY5=93d14